Oracle Database 11g R2 インストール環境の設定2014/10/05 |
Oracle Database 11g R2 をインストールします。まずはインストールするための環境設定をします。
|
|
[1] |
こちらを参考にデスクトップ環境をインストールしておきます。
|
[2] | 必要なものを事前にインストールしておきます。 |
[root@db01 ~]# yum -y install binutils compat-libstdc++-33 compat-libstdc++-33.i686 ksh elfutils-libelf elfutils-libelf-devel glibc glibc-common glibc-devel gcc gcc-c++ libaio libaio.i686 libaio-devel libaio-devel.i686 libgcc libstdc++ libstdc++.i686 libstdc++-devel libstdc++-devel.i686 make sysstat unixODBC unixODBC-devel |
[3] | カーネルパラメータを編集します。 |
[root@db01 ~]#
vi /etc/sysctl.conf # 以下コメント化 # net.bridge.bridge-nf-call-ip6tables = 0# net.bridge.bridge-nf-call-iptables = 0# net.bridge.bridge-nf-call-arptables = 0# 最終行に追記
net.ipv4.ip_local_port_range = 9000 65500 fs.file-max = 6815744 kernel.shmall = 10523004 kernel.shmmax = 6465333657 kernel.shmmni = 4096 kernel.sem = 250 32000 100 128 net.core.rmem_default=262144 net.core.wmem_default=262144 net.core.rmem_max=4194304 net.core.wmem_max=1048576 fs.aio-max-nr = 1048576 sysctl -p net.ipv4.ip_forward = 0 net.ipv4.conf.default.rp_filter = 1 net.ipv4.conf.default.accept_source_route = 0 kernel.sysrq = 0 kernel.core_uses_pid = 1 net.ipv4.tcp_syncookies = 1 net.ipv4.ip_local_port_range = 9000 65500 fs.file-max = 65536 kernel.shmall = 10523004 kernel.shmmax = 6465333657 kernel.shmmni = 4096 kernel.sem = 250 32000 100 128 net.core.rmem_default = 262144 net.core.wmem_default = 262144 net.core.rmem_max = 4194304 net.core.wmem_max = 1048576 fs.aio-max-nr = 1048576 |
[4] | オラクル専用のユーザー/グループを作成し、システムの環境設定をします。 |
[root@db01 ~]# groupadd -g 200 oinstall [root@db01 ~]# groupadd -g 201 dba [root@db01 ~]# useradd -u 440 -g oinstall -G dba -d /usr/oracle oracle [root@db01 ~]# passwd oracle Changing password for user oracle. New password: Retype new password: passwd: all authentication tokens updated successfully.
[root@db01 ~]#
vi /etc/pam.d/login # 14行目あたりに追記 session required pam_selinux.so open session required pam_namespace.so session required pam_limits.so session optional pam_keyinit.so force revoke session include system-auth -session optional pam_ck_connector.so
[root@db01 ~]#
vi /etc/security/limits.conf # 最終行に追記
oracle soft nproc 2047
oracle hard nproc 16384 oracle soft nofile 1024 oracle hard nofile 65536
[root@db01 ~]#
vi /etc/profile # 最終行に追記
if [ $USER = "oracle" ]; then if [ $SHELL = "/bin/ksh" ]; then ulimit -p 16384 ulimit -n 65536 else ulimit -u 16384 -n 65536 fi fi |
[5] | Oracle用の環境設定をしておきます。作業は[3]で作成した「Oracle」ユーザーで行います。以上でインストールするための準備は完了です。 |
db01 login:
Password:oracle
[oracle@db01 ~]$ chmod 755 /usr/oracle [oracle@db01 ~]$ mkdir /usr/oracle/app [oracle@db01 ~]$ chmod 775 /usr/oracle/app [oracle@db01 ~]$ mkdir /usr/oracle/oradata [oracle@db01 ~]$ chmod 775 /usr/oracle/oradata
[oracle@db01 ~]$
vi ~/.bash_profile # 最終行に追記
umask 022
export ORACLE_BASE=/usr/oracle/app # インストール作業用一時Dir作成 [oracle@db01 ~]$ mkdir tmp
|
Sponsored Link |